Handover note — Crumbwheel order cutoffs.

Welcome aboard. The bakery cutoff rule in Crumbwheel closes same-day orders at 14:00 local to each storefront, not UTC — this has bitten us twice. Holiday overrides live in the calendar service and take precedence silently, so always check there first when a cutoff looks wrong. To unlock the calendar service's admin console after a restart, enter the recovery passphrase below.

vault phrase of bagap-bahaf = silion-pelox-sorox-casdor-quenwyn-fraax-eliox-praael-kelion-quenvan-kasox-rusael-norius-belvan

This change adds soft deletes to the orders table in Fernhollow Commerce. Rows get a deleted_at timestamp instead of being removed, and all read paths filter on it via the active_orders view. A nightly sweeper hard-deletes rows past the retention window. If you add a new query path, use the view, not the raw table. The sweeper's behavior is governed by the constants listed below.

limits module of tafop-hahop:
WEIGHTS = {
    "julmir": 223,
    "belox": 987,
    "lamion": 470,
    "pelath": 609,
    "fraok": 1010,
    "eliion": 343,
    "drudor": 342,
}

Purpose: approve launch of Atlascope Premium, our new top subscription tier. Key points: bundles the Farlane forecasting module, doubles seat limits, adds priority support. Pilot conversion in the Denmoor region hit 14%. Pricing set 30% above the Standard tier. Launch target: start of next quarter. Risks: cannibalization of Standard upgrades, support load. Heads of department must confirm staffing readiness by Friday. Decision required at review. Note the confidential item below before circulating anything.

board note of tadup-tajog: Headcount on the Oliiel team goes from 31 to 88 by the end of February. Gross margin on Oliiel came in at 62 percent against a plan of 29 percent.